Pre control Strategies in Power Grid Dispatch Operation Under new Circumstances
The widespread application of new energy and the rapid changes in the electricity market have brought unprece-dented challenges and opportunities to the dispatch and operation of the power grid.In this context,exploring efficient pre control strategies has become the key to ensuring the safe and stable operation of the power grid.This article provides an in-depth analysis of the characteristics of power grid dispatch operation under the new situation,highlighting core issues such as system overload risk,insufficient frequency and voltage regulation capabilities,cross regional transmission channel congestion,and information system security vulnerabilities.In response to these issues,pre control strategies such as en-hancing the system's peak shaving capability,improving frequency and voltage regulation technology,optimizing cross re-gional transmission strategies,and strengthening information system security have been proposed,providing effective so-lutions for power grid scheduling and operation,with the aim of providing reference for power grid managers and policy makers.
